How guest reviews work
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Ideally, we would publish every review we receive, whether positive or negative. However, we won’t display any review that includes or refers to (among other things):
- Politically sensitive comments
- Promotional content
- Illegal activities
- Personal or sensitive information (e.g. emails, phone numbers or credit card info)
- Swear words, sexual references, hate speech, discriminatory remarks, threats, or references to violence
- Spam and fake content
- Animal cruelty
- Impersonation (e.g. if the writer is claiming to be someone else)
- Any violation of our review guidelines.
To make sure reviews are relevant, we may only accept reviews that are submitted within 3 months of checking out, and we may stop showing reviews once they’re 36 months old – or if the Accommodation has a change of ownership.
